MISSOURI RENDEZVOUS
Here is the story of how it began.
Last year there was a spyder and two wheeler event at Fort Lenard Wood in support of the USO on post.
Great turn out with people coming from all over the country. I met Len on his spyder who happens to own the Cow Town spyder dealership in Cuba Mo. As usual spyder riders start off being friends and it grows from that point on.
Months later I was getting an oil change and Len and I started brainstorming about a Spyder event.
Here is what we came up with.
MISSOURI RENDEZVOUS
Cuba Ride April 17th and 18th
Len has offered up a free BBQ lunch and is working on a free dinner I of course accepted for us.
There will be 3 RT's available for Demo Rides
I'm asking each person that attends to pay $5.00 entry fee. I wanted to use those dollars for a cash drawing then Len offered to match our total entry fees. The winner of a drawing will have the total to buy BRP goodies at Cow Town. He also mentioned that he will have attendance bags for everyone.
Cow Town has its own test track and lake. Len suggested that we test ride some of the other BRP products.
Since Cow Town has 6 trained spyder tech's he plans on doing maintenance and oil changes at a reduced price If anyone needs service
I also asked if he would lead our group on a scenic route thru the country side and back before dinner time. He would be more than happy to show us around Cuba's twisties.
Motel in Cuba for those that want to stay overnight.
Holiday Inn Express
97 Ozark Drive, Cuba - (573) 885-0100
